My next suggestion for all you gift- givers is a gift card. Again, so simple. But this will guarantee that they are happy with what they get (who better to pick a gift than the person themself?). If you do go with this choice but don't know the person very well, stick with the basics: food, music, and clothes. Everyone needs to eat, so giving someone  gift card for a restaurant like Chipotle, Subway, or Starbucks can be beneficial to anybody. If you want to go with the music option, give an iTunes card; because everybody loves music. Now for the third option, you can either go with an actual store card, or you could go with the easiest choice yet, and give a Visa gift card. Whichever kind of card you give them, I'm sure they will highly rejoice because everyone loves free stuff.
